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ration

Under the guidelines of 49 CFR 382.305, companies must implement a random testing program that complies with federal standards. Owner-operators in Gibraltar, PA are required to join a consortium pool consisting of two or more covered employees.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10%- D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

USCG - United States Coast Guard under the watch of homeland security in Gibraltar, PA, mandates marine employers per 46 CFR Part 16.230, to execute random drug testing for safety-sensitive crewmembers, reinforcing the commitment to maritime safety.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ances through DOT 5-panel urine tests form the testing basis, essential for detecting substance misuse and ensuring the preparedness of personnel.
  • Note that Alcohol is currently not required for USCG random minimums, maintaining focus on controlled substances for this sector.

For those governed by the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) under 14 CFR Part 120, it is compulsory to incorporate all safety-sensitive roles in Gibraltar, PA and across the nation.

  • 25%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10%-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

Railroads operating within Gibraltar, PA are obligated to devise and adhere to a random testing strategy that has been sanctioned by the FRA as stipulated in 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. This strategic approach towards safety ensures compliance and upholds operational standards, protecting both staff and passengers.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

As regulated under 49 CFR Part 655, employers associated with public transit in Gibraltar, PA are required to utilize an empirically valid mechanism for employee selection. This regulation emphasizes the importance of methodical and unbiased selection protocols to ensure safety-sensitive positions are scrutinized rigorously.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

Entities regulated by Parts 192, 193, or 195 are required to engage in drug testing of covered employees as per 49 CFR Part 199. Within Gibraltar, PA, adherence to these regulations is critical to maintaining safety standards in the handling and transportation of hazardous materials.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

A C/TPA is a service provider that oversees either part or all of an employer's drug and alcohol testing program, coordinating random testing pools according to 49 CFR part 40 regulations.

Are random testing percentages always fixed or variable?

The rates for DOT random testing can fluctuate each year depending on the positivity rate; however, within our consortium, every DOT random testing fee is covered, regardless of the rate.

What occurs when I'm notified for a random test?

ADT will inform the company DER or Owner Operator via email/phone with details about the nearest testing location and guide them on the necessary steps. Once informed, the selected individual must promptly head to the testing site.

What substances are screened in a DOT drug test?

The DOT drug test checks for a DOT 5-panel urine and conducts a DOT breath alcohol test. It is essential that all tests are performed using a Federal CCF form alongside a Federal Alcohol Testing Form.
